Diwali DIY Decoration idea No. 1: Taking centre stage with a Diwali Centrepiece.

I am using this metal baking tray which is as old as the hills and looking like them too. But going on with the JUNK to JOY series everything has a purpose and can be up cycled into something useful.



I chose to cover the old baking tray with this marble print contact paper. Contact paper has its own adhesive so all I did was peel it and stick it.




Just added the flowers and for the light source you can use any battery operated candle or lamp. The marble contact paper, flowers and the lamp add the sparkle back to the old tray and this centrepiece would look pretty on any table.

DIY decoration idea without glue No. 1: Hanging planter shelf


You will need 1 wooden coaster, this coaster is 7 inches in diameter and one which has grooves like this and any thick string. Length of each string is 55 inches, but you can customize it accordingly. You will need 2 such strings.


 Just treadle the string from opposite ends of the coaster so that it looks like this from the front.


And like this at the back. Then add a tight knot at the top and we are done. 



I added this beautiful Peace Lily plant, it easily took its weight  and it makes the room looks so pretty.



You could also try faux plants like this succulent. This DIY looks like it’s a floating , hanging shelf/planter all you have to do is hang it in your room and it brings the room to life.

DIY decoration idea without glue No.2: Wall decor.


You will need the same wooden coaster and any artificial flowers of your choice.

Then I just adjusted these flowers into these groves and fussed over them till I was happy with its composition. This one is a no brainer, really easy. Within minutes you have a cute wall decoration ready for your room. I did not use any tape or glue the flowers stayed on by themselves.
